git: openjdk/riscv-port-jdk17u: riscv-port: 15 new changesets
duke
duke at openjdk.org
Mon May 29 00:47:59 UTC 2023
Changeset: fe17568e
Author: Matthias Baesken <mbaesken at openjdk.org>
Date: 2023-05-25 08:47:32 +0000
URL: https://git.openjdk.org/riscv-port-jdk17u/commit/fe17568ea90b1f23b924474ce6b38a8f1e9f4d45
8307135: java/awt/dnd/NotReallySerializableTest/NotReallySerializableTest.java failed
Backport-of: d43a5a289f4ac84480bf54ab304c1ce1dbc8e067
! test/jdk/java/awt/dnd/NotReallySerializableTest/NotReallySerializableTest.java
Changeset: 861fe74b
Author: Aleksey Shipilev <shade at openjdk.org>
Date: 2023-05-25 09:03:14 +0000
URL: https://git.openjdk.org/riscv-port-jdk17u/commit/861fe74ba20fd807528d4eef6669bbef3fc65074
8274615: Support relaxed atomic add for linux-aarch64
Reviewed-by: aph
Backport-of: 8de26361f7d789c7b317536198c891756038a8ea
! src/hotspot/cpu/aarch64/atomic_aarch64.hpp
! src/hotspot/cpu/aarch64/stubGenerator_aarch64.cpp
! src/hotspot/os_cpu/linux_aarch64/atomic_linux_aarch64.S
! src/hotspot/os_cpu/linux_aarch64/atomic_linux_aarch64.hpp
Changeset: 50aabaa9
Author: Arno Zeller <azeller at openjdk.org>
Committer: Matthias Baesken <mbaesken at openjdk.org>
Date: 2023-05-25 09:12:22 +0000
URL: https://git.openjdk.org/riscv-port-jdk17u/commit/50aabaa9ca4adbaf82d1d92d8f07f9f9cbf7a8fa
8307347: serviceability/sa/ClhsdbDumpclass.java could leave files owned by root on macOS
Backport-of: 5c7ede94ae59b46c12d40a38bf5b7e15319cc7e2
! test/hotspot/jtreg/serviceability/sa/ClhsdbDumpclass.java
Changeset: 436d96fd
Author: Aleksey Shipilev <shade at openjdk.org>
Date: 2023-05-25 11:38:03 +0000
URL: https://git.openjdk.org/riscv-port-jdk17u/commit/436d96fd12236c42850be9e02803a68c839f6206
8275287: Relax memory ordering constraints on updating instance class and array class counters
Backport-of: 002c538bc03f55fa600f331a66242ee8575919dc
! src/hotspot/share/classfile/classLoaderDataGraph.inline.hpp
Changeset: 57d0a7f1
Author: Alexey Pavlyutkin <apavlyutkin at azul.com>
Committer: Yuri Nesterenko <yan at openjdk.org>
Date: 2023-05-25 13:49:29 +0000
URL: https://git.openjdk.org/riscv-port-jdk17u/commit/57d0a7f1b69214bd2de951c9907fe1321a66f3b8
8300939: sun/security/provider/certpath/OCSP/OCSPNoContentLength.java fails due to network errors
Reviewed-by: goetz
Backport-of: da044dd5698d14eccd2a30a24cc691e30fa00cbd
! test/jdk/java/security/testlibrary/SimpleOCSPServer.java
! test/jdk/sun/security/provider/certpath/OCSP/OCSPNoContentLength.java
Changeset: 14779b1f
Author: Aleksey Shipilev <shade at openjdk.org>
Date: 2023-05-25 18:34:42 +0000
URL: https://git.openjdk.org/riscv-port-jdk17u/commit/14779b1f4e82cb0576e4d8d208ee20f256b4ccc2
8294717: (bf) DirectByteBuffer constructor will leak if allocating Deallocator or Cleaner fails with OOME
Backport-of: 4cbac40de956974760cf54183b3ba29f0b5ec331
! src/java.base/share/classes/java/nio/Direct-X-Buffer.java.template
Changeset: c581886c
Author: Victor Rudometov <vrudomet at openjdk.org>
Committer: Paul Hohensee <phh at openjdk.org>
Date: 2023-05-25 18:53:11 +0000
URL: https://git.openjdk.org/riscv-port-jdk17u/commit/c581886c15f0f4352e37a042959cd78eb080d6e4
8307128: Open source some drag and drop tests 4
8307799: Newly added java/awt/dnd/MozillaDnDTest.java has invalid jtreg `@requires` clause
Reviewed-by: phh
Backport-of: 98294242a94c611e2a713c2d520e59dd873ae4a0
+ test/jdk/java/awt/dnd/MouseExitGestureTriggerTest.java
+ test/jdk/java/awt/dnd/MozillaDnDTest.java
+ test/jdk/java/awt/dnd/MultiDataFlavorDropTest.java
+ test/jdk/java/awt/dnd/NativeDragJavaDropTest.java
+ test/jdk/java/awt/dnd/NestedHeavyweightDropTargetTest.java
Changeset: 5bf1b9a5
Author: Aleksey Shipilev <shade at openjdk.org>
Date: 2023-05-25 19:02:09 +0000
URL: https://git.openjdk.org/riscv-port-jdk17u/commit/5bf1b9a53485b571095b934f65c2d6143f748d4f
8283520: JFR: Memory leak in dcmd_arena
Backport-of: 6a8be358d2af34fab8798077202b998badaa5d54
! src/hotspot/share/jfr/dcmd/jfrDcmds.cpp
! src/hotspot/share/jfr/support/jfrThreadLocal.cpp
! src/hotspot/share/jfr/support/jfrThreadLocal.hpp
Changeset: 0d2cc357
Author: Aleksey Shipilev <shade at openjdk.org>
Date: 2023-05-25 19:10:53 +0000
URL: https://git.openjdk.org/riscv-port-jdk17u/commit/0d2cc357dc6547896de34b5c580fa1a83ad15e9f
8292713: Unsafe.allocateInstance should be intrinsified without UseUnalignedAccesses
Backport-of: c0623972cffdbcd7f80e84a1ec344fd382a4a5cc
! src/hotspot/share/classfile/vmIntrinsics.cpp
Changeset: 6803da9a
Author: Matthias Baesken <mbaesken at openjdk.org>
Date: 2023-05-26 06:49:42 +0000
URL: https://git.openjdk.org/riscv-port-jdk17u/commit/6803da9a4717211e67a65d638526c0a2392ff41a
8301661: Enhance os::pd_print_cpu_info on macOS and Windows
Backport-of: 9145670354c41381614877aa71895dc2bd5cce9d
! make/autoconf/libraries.m4
! src/hotspot/os/bsd/os_bsd.cpp
! src/hotspot/os/windows/os_windows.cpp
Changeset: 6287df05
Author: Aleksey Shipilev <shade at openjdk.org>
Date: 2023-05-26 07:42:09 +0000
URL: https://git.openjdk.org/riscv-port-jdk17u/commit/6287df05cee5781da1c223ed6084d0b2fcc6959b
8286346: 3-parameter version of AllocateHeap should not ignore AllocFailType
Backport-of: 64b05ccbed7879dd38a49453a6098bfe9729ee76
! src/hotspot/share/memory/allocation.cpp
Changeset: 3d32a20e
Author: Aleksey Shipilev <shade at openjdk.org>
Date: 2023-05-26 10:52:43 +0000
URL: https://git.openjdk.org/riscv-port-jdk17u/commit/3d32a20e8921540f148adb9f8b7bd6a46c07d08f
8286331: jni_GetStringUTFChars() uses wrong heap allocator
Backport-of: b0d2b0a3553cbb2db23d543b98ab1401b3dbfa91
! src/hotspot/share/prims/jni.cpp
! src/hotspot/share/utilities/nativeCallStack.hpp
Changeset: 6919ff2c
Author: Andrew John Hughes <andrew at openjdk.org>
Date: 2023-05-26 14:31:03 +0000
URL: https://git.openjdk.org/riscv-port-jdk17u/commit/6919ff2cb00e4f672df30ac0a72bf038e1e8e8d2
8301119: Support for GB18030-2022
Reviewed-by: sgehwolf
Backport-of: a253b4602147633a3d2e83775d1feef4f12a5272
! make/data/charsetmapping/charsets
! make/data/charsetmapping/stdcs-aix
! make/data/charsetmapping/stdcs-linux
- make/data/charsetmapping/stdcs-solaris
! make/data/charsetmapping/stdcs-windows
! make/jdk/src/classes/build/tools/charsetmapping/SPI.java
= src/java.base/share/classes/sun/nio/cs/GB18030.java
! src/java.base/share/classes/sun/nio/cs/StandardCharsets.java.template
! src/jdk.charsets/share/classes/sun/nio/cs/ext/ExtendedCharsets.java.template
! test/jdk/java/nio/charset/Charset/RegisteredCharsets.java
! test/jdk/sun/nio/cs/TestGB18030.java
! test/jdk/sun/nio/cs/mapping/CoderTest.java
! test/jdk/sun/nio/cs/mapping/GB18030.b2c
= test/jdk/sun/nio/cs/mapping/GB18030_2000.b2c
Changeset: 16843770
Author: Alexey Bakhtin <abakhtin at openjdk.org>
Date: 2023-05-26 17:41:05 +0000
URL: https://git.openjdk.org/riscv-port-jdk17u/commit/16843770b5a9a56ff0689b1f70cc5768dfaa7a57
8303809: Dispose context in SPNEGO NegotiatorImpl
Backport-of: 10f16746254ce62031f40ffb0f49f22e81cbe631
! src/java.base/share/classes/sun/net/www/protocol/http/AuthenticationInfo.java
! src/java.base/share/classes/sun/net/www/protocol/http/HttpURLConnection.java
! src/java.base/share/classes/sun/net/www/protocol/http/NegotiateAuthentication.java
! src/java.base/share/classes/sun/net/www/protocol/http/Negotiator.java
! src/java.security.jgss/share/classes/sun/net/www/protocol/http/spnego/NegotiatorImpl.java
Changeset: ace2c5c3
Author: Fei Yang <yangfei at iscas.ac.cn>
Date: 2023-05-28 15:20:32 +0000
URL: https://git.openjdk.org/riscv-port-jdk17u/commit/ace2c5c30dd53faa4929fce4397e797584cde26f
Merge branch 'master' into riscv-port
! make/autoconf/libraries.m4
! make/autoconf/libraries.m4
More information about the riscv-port-dev
mailing list